In the Backyard Near the Shed the first garden the rabbit found without a metal fence was full of weeds laced with long gray hair which swung limp in the warm summer wind dancing off the breath of playful love behind her grandparents shed with a twelve year old boy the rabbits nose shoveled the dirt and sneezed the dirt onto its whiskers without carrots or peppers or cabbage smell the rabbit left the garden and heard the long gray hair's whisper to the wind- they won't last "The Writer's Cramp" Prompt: write a short story or poem about a conversation in a garden.
